Army soldiers assigned to Alpha Battery, 5th Battalion, 3rd Field Artillery Regiment (Long Range Fires Battalion), 1st Multi-Domain Task Force, based at Joint Base Lewis Mc-Chord, Washington, prepare to move M142 High Mobility Artillery Rocket System (HIMARS) to a firing location as part of the 11th Airborne Division's force projection operation to Shemya Island, Alaska, Sept. 12, 2024. The division’s ability to project power quickly and effectively assures allies and partner nations in the Indo-Pacific, and is the key to the strength of partnerships and relationships in the region.
